Tehran Times - Branko Ivankovic will reportedly extend his contract with Persepolis football club after the match against Al Jazira of the UAE.

Persepolis will host the Emirati football team on May 14 in Tehran’s Azadi Stadium.

The Iranian giants lost to Al Jazira 3-2 in the first leg of the AFC Champions League Round of 16 in Dubai.

The Iranian media reports suggest that Ivankovic will extend his contract after the second leg.

In January, the Persepolis club announced that Ivankovic has extended his contract until 2021 but it seems no contract has been signed yet.

The Croat has led Persepolis to Iran Professional League back-to-back titles and advanced to 2017 AFC Champions League semis.

Persepolis also are favorite to win ACL title in current season after advancing to the Round of 16 as the group winners.

Ivankovic has already worked at Saudi Arabian football club Ettifaq in 2011-12.

The 64-year-old coach has also been linked with a move to Uzbekistan football team.
